Here's my mk1
I bought it in may 2006
It's 1.8 8v
1983
When i bought it, it needed a good amount of work
( But that's where the fun is & What it's all about )
the brake's were very very bad
the car could hardly move no power
the glove box was broken where it screw's to the dash,
(New dash needed)
no horn (The car :roll: ), very bad light's,No indicator's, Hard to get 5th gear
(The linkage's were worn & broke)
Window wiper's would only work on 1 speed very very very slow,
no rev counter, no dash lights etc
Body wise it was fairly straight,Paint was fair & after that everything else
could be fixed
Theese pic's were taken the morning after i got it,
the car looked a lot better after a good wash it brought the paint
right up got rid of the dirt and grime
It also came with this leather interior (now changed)
I don't like the blue but the seat's are in good condition,
i'll change the blue bit's in time, (there on the to do list)
Rear Strut
The service history show's that
before i got it, it got
Bush's balljoint's & service bit's filter's,shocks etc
also
Radiator 15.12.97
Steer rack 24.01.98
Engine work 10.04.98
Clutch cable 27.07.98
Fuse box 29.08.98
4 Branch manifold down pipe 16.11.98
Expansion tank & cap 08.03.99
Speedocable 13.05.99
New exhaust box's 20.04.05
New front & back bumper 18.05.05
and it passed the nct (National car test) on 30.06.04
This is a picture i took of the car about a year after i got it,
Done to this point is
Full service,
Brake problem sorted out with mk2 16v servo,
G60 master cylinder,
Rear Brake Caliper's & disc's,
Braided brake hose's (goodridge)
scirocco gti hand brake cable's
No power problem sorted
incorrect distributor cap was fitted
changed for new one along
with plug lead's, New rotor and ignition timming done
few small thing's i got at inter's 07
Bonnet lifter's
number plate's, number plate surround's
tinted head light's also this de badged grill
which i hate, (really look's bad on a black car i think)
i should have left the original double headlight grill on it
but you know what it's like, you want to change the
look of a car when you 1st get it

Next job prepare for nct (National car test done every 2 year's) same test as your mot
Sort out the headlight's with relay's & replace / tidy up wiring,
Got a dash at inter's 2nd hand in good nick fitted that
Fit mk2 wiper motor
Fit new horn and sort out earth problem
Sparco foot pedal's
Got clock's from ebay and took bit's from it to fix
original set
& a good few other bit's & pieces
Passed test on 11.03.2008
Northside Dublin meet march 08
1st Kildare meet
Limerick 08
Getting car ready for Inter's 08 & doing a few more job's
that were left on the back burner
May 08
Clutch kit & Clutch cable
Water pump & housing & Thermostat
Timing belt & Tensioner
New Timing belt cover
Full service
